what is the base or root word of inhospitable

Respuesta :

W0lf93
W0lf93 W0lf93
  • 28-08-2017
the answer is hospitable or hospitality, which refers to the way people treat other people who come into their home. It is an adjective. A hospitable person appears friendly and caring whereas inhospitable is the opposite.
